200 Dollars to Euros – Easy Conversion Explained

200 dollars is approximately 186.00 euros.

This conversion is based on the current exchange rate of 1 USD equals 0.93 EUR. By multiplying 200 dollars by 0.93, you get the equivalent value in euros, which helps when planning travel expenses or international purchases.

Conversion Formula

The formula to convert dollars to euros is:

Euros = Dollars × Exchange Rate

Here, the exchange rate is the value of one US dollar in euros. The rate changes daily due to market conditions but for this example, we use 0.93.

Because 1 USD = 0.93 EUR, multiplying the dollar amount by 0.93 gives you the euro equivalent.

Example calculation for 200 dollars:

  • Start with 200 dollars
  • Multiply by 0.93 (exchange rate)
  • 200 × 0.93 = 186 euros

Conversion FAQs

Why does the exchange rate between dollars and euros change?

Exchange rates vary because of market forces like supply and demand, economic indicators, interest rates, and geopolitical events. These factors cause the value of the dollar or euro to fluctuate against each other daily, affecting how much one currency buys of the other.

Do banks give the exact exchange rate shown online when converting 200 dollars?

Usually, banks apply a margin or fee that makes the rate less favorable than the market rate you see online. This means converting 200 dollars at a bank might yield fewer euros than expected because of service charges or commissions.

How does currency conversion affect international shopping with 200 dollars?

The conversion rate determines the euro price you pay when using dollars abroad. If the rate changes unfavorably, 200 dollars may buy fewer goods or services. Also, some merchants add fees for foreign currency payments, impacting the final cost.

Is it better to convert 200 dollars at airports or local banks?

Airport exchange counters often have worse rates and higher fees, so converting 200 dollars there tends to be more expensive. Local banks or online conversion services usually offer better rates and lower fees, saving money on conversions.

Can I convert parts of 200 dollars multiple times to euros?

Yes, you can convert smaller amounts multiple times, but each transaction might incur fees or less favorable rates. Breaking 200 dollars into parts for conversion can reduce the total euros received due to repeated fees or spread in rates.
